I'm working on integrating slide within an existing application.  I'm using the 
same context for the application and with slide.  I'm having troubles mapping a 
drive under XP *and* OS X.
 
Some background: 
 
My context path is "/app".  In production we have both Apache and Tomcat on 
separate servers.  Apache is serving up static files from /images, /js, /css, 
etc.  Apache has a mapped JkMount of /app/*.  My URL to access the webdav share 
is: http://domain/app/webdav.  I can browse the webdav filesystem through a 
browser without a problem.  When I map a drive in XP, it returns with the 
message: "The folder you entered does not appear to be valid..."  OS X returns 
something along the same lines.
 
I read through several discussions on the mailing list.  One of those is the 
discussion found when searching for "Windows XP Mapping."  It was stated that 
the root dir needs to be webdav enabled for drive mapping.  I won't state my 
thoughts on how frustrating I think that is.  :)  
 
How do you get around it if you can't have the application context mapped to 
the root?  Is there anyone else out there that has gone through this situation?
